Output f84a65b610e8cf16e36069e49024c7ac82e6efc2a96d5d20b55bdd6b043b1e7f:5

value
2448631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98142554a65383334d42882c0464f6d7f43b0726 OP_EQUAL
address
3FZ8mTXwy32gvfGgcfFnLJctr2ZgwYdhww
transaction
f84a65b610e8cf16e36069e49024c7ac82e6efc2a96d5d20b55bdd6b043b1e7f
spent
true